Addiction and Mental Health - Community Addiction Services

Provides outpatient assessment, treatment, and follow-up for individuals across the lifespan experiencing addiction related concerns.

Support for individuals and families who have concerns surrounding alcohol, drugs, gambling, and tobacco use. Support for process/behavioural addictions (ex: gaming, sex, pornography, etc) may also be accessed in consultation with Mental Health Therapists and/or Psychiatrist. Services may include

  • individual counselling
  • family support sessions
  • education
  • overdose prevention & Naloxone training
  • relapse prevention, and referrals to recovery supports.

Addictions Counselling is aimed to prevent, reduce, and recover from the harmful effects of substance use and gambling.
